Quality control measures in manufacturing can significantly impact the effectiveness of corrosion inhibitors. A study published in the Journal of Protective Coatings and Linings emphasizes that the presence of impurities or improper formulation can lead to predictably poorer inhibition performance. Ensuring the right balance of active ingredients is essential for maximizing protection against corrosion. Moreover, certifications such as ISO 9001 for manufacturing processes serve as indicators of a manufacturer’s commitment to quality, which can give businesses confidence in sourcing reliable and effective corrosion inhibitors. When selecting corrosion inhibitor manufacturers in global sourcing, several key factors must be taken into account to ensure quality and effectiveness. First and foremost, one should evaluate the manufacturer’s certifications and compliance with international standards. This not only reflects their commitment to quality but also assures that their products are reliable and tested under rigorous conditions. Additionally, researching the manufacturer's history and reputation in the industry can provide insight into their consistency and reliability as a supplier.
Another critical factor is the range of products and customization options offered by the manufacturer. Corrosion inhibitors are not one-size-fits-all solutions; different industries and applications may require specialized formulations. A manufacturer that provides tailored solutions can better meet specific needs, enhancing overall performance and longevity. Moreover, considering the manufacturer’s technological capabilities and R&D investments can be indicative of their innovation and ability to adapt to market changes, ensuring that clients have access to the latest advancements in corrosion protection.
